Daily iPhone App: The Walk adds some danger and intrigue to your daily routine

You may remember Six to Start for its smash fitness app, Zombies, Run!. The app combines running with a narrated storyline that allows you to play the role of a survivor of the zombie apocalypse. The game studio, along with Naomi Alderman, is back with a follow-up thriller, The Walk, that tracks your steps and tells you a story as you walk.

In The Walk, you star as the survivor of an explosion on a London train. You unwittingly end up with a package that could save the world, but you need to get it out of the city. As you walk in real life, you will move about the city's map avoiding police and following the voice instructions from your faithful guide. Walking also unlocks additional audio clips and allows you to gather collectibles on the map, both of which flesh out the rest of the story.

The Walk is less immersive than its Zombies, Run! counterpart, but equally compelling. Unlike Zombies, Run!, which talks to you throughout your run, The Walk is meant for you to go for a walk, pull out your phone to find some collectibles, unlock a few audio clips and then move on. It's great for people who walk to work or school or walk for pleasure and want some rewards for the time they spend on their feet. Just like Zombies, Run!, the storyline sucks you in and encourages you to get moving, even if it's just for a short jaunt.

The Walk is available for US$2.99 from the iOS App Store.
